CPU usage of gala extremly high after adding panel

Open BetaConnector opened this issue 5 years ago • 3 comments

Hello,

i am using elementary OS 5.1 Hera.

When I am creating a new Panel on the Desktop the CPU usage get high on the Laptop: Bildschirmfoto von 2020-01-07 11-39-37

After removing the Panel the CPU usag gets normal again (about 1%).

PC: Dell Lattitude 5401 Version of desktop folder: 1.1.2

Any Ideas how to fix that problem?

Hi, well, in my tests I have a "Intel(R) Core(TM) i5-3320M CPU @ 2.60GHz" and 8GB. When the desktop is being rendered the CPU was about 9%, if the desktop is not being rendered (behind an opaque window on top for example), then it was about 2%. Not sure what is happening there, because there is not any process if you are not moving the mouse over the panels... the only point is the GTK rendering process, but that's something I can't control.
